Roasted Banana Split Ice Cream Sandwiches

Ingredients

Scale

Chocolate Cookie

  • 2 Cups All Purpose Flour
  • 1/2 Cup Cocoa Powder
  • 1/4 tsp Salt
  • 1 Cup (2 sticks) Butter, Unsalted
  • 1 1/2 Cups Powdered Sugar
  • 2 Egg Yolks
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ract

Roasted Banana Ice Cream

  • 3 Bananas
  • 2 Cups Heavy Cream
  • 1 Cup Whole Milk
  • 1 Cup Granulated Sugar
  • 5 Egg Yolks
  • 1 vanilla bean, split

Instructions

Chocolate Cookie

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F
  2. Combine flour, cocoa powder and salt and set aside
  3. In a large mixing bowl, cream together butter and powdered sugar and mix until smooth
  4. Add in eggs yolks and vanilla extract and mix until combined
  5. Scrape down butter mixture and slowly add dry ingredients until dough has come together
  6. Remove the dough from the mixing bowl, shape into a rectangle, c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ate for approximately 1 hour or until chilled
  7. Roll the chocolate dough to 1/4 inch thick and cut into 3 inch squares and place on parchment lined sheet pan
  8. Using a skewer, poke nine evenly spaced holes into each cookie before baking
  9. Bake for 15 minutes at 350 degrees F
  10. Allow the cookies to cool completely before assembling

Roasted Banana Ice Cream

  1. Preheat oven to 325 degrees F
  2. Place 3 unpeeled banana on a parchment lined sheet pan and roast until skin is completely black, approximately 20 minutes
  3. Allow the bananas to cool completely, peel, mash and set aside
  4. In a bowl, whisk together the egg yolks and half of the sugar
  5. In a saucepan combine heavy cream, milk, 1/2 of sugar and vanilla bean
  6. Once it comes to a simmer, slowly whisk 1/2 of the milk mixture into egg yolk mixture
  7. Add the egg yolk mixture back into the saucepan, stirring constantly for 1 minute
  8. Add the mashed bananas into custard and cook for 3-4 minutes or until custard becomes thick and coats the back of a wood spoon
  9. Using an immersion blender, pulse mixture until smooth
  10. Strain mixture into a large bowl to remove any cooked eggs or banana pieces
  11. Cover custard and refrigerate until cold
  12. Once the mixture is cold, make the ice cream according to your ice cream machine instructions.
  13. Spread the frozen ice cream into a 9x9 inch parchment lined pan, cover and freeze overnight
  14. Remove the molded ice cream from the pan and cut into 3 inch squares
  15. Assemble Ice Cream Sandwiches and freeze until ready to serve
  16. Serve with optional toppings or enjoy on their own!

Notes

  • Toppings: (optional)
  • Fresh Whipped Cream
  • Maraschino Cherries
  • Chopped Pecan
  • Toasted Coconut
  • Chocolate Sauce
